Forgery in Putnam County, Florida
Based on 12 Forgery cases in Putnam County (2023-2025), 66.7% resulted in a guilty finding, 25.0% had adjudication withheld, and 0.0% were dismissed. The average sentence for convicted defendants is 1 year, 2 months, with an average fine of $60.00. 0.0% of defendants retained private counsel while 25.0% used a public defender.

About this data: Statistics are derived from FDLE Criminal Justice Data Transparency records for Putnam County. "Guilty" includes all cases where the defendant was found guilty. "Adjudication withheld" is a Florida-specific disposition where guilt is found but the court withholds formal adjudication under FL Statute 948.01. "Dismissed" includes all cases dismissed by the court or prosecution.
